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3658847 90264 968945296
9429 710724
9429 710724
49166310 598977 7686015
All about undefined
Interested in learning more?
9429 710724
49166310 598977 7686015
See more
098528524 0316465718
995 3008 89670632 7744136
See more
74 220820614
14639592723 792 6972
See more